More about the book
Set against the backdrop of New York City, Sergeant Samuel, now in traffic police, partners with the devout officer Huang. His encounter with Olis, a street singer with a mysterious past, leads him into a web of corruption tied to the Vatican. As Samuel, aided by conflicted gang leader Melera, investigates, he uncovers the exploitation of innocent individuals by church officials driven by greed. Ultimately, Samuel must choose between his moral convictions and exposing the dark secrets of Cardinal Marchetto Caccini, challenging the very foundations of faith and loyalty.
